Antifa

Context: U.S. President Donald Trump announced plans to designate Antifa a terrorist organisation after the killing of conservative activist Charlie Kirk. About Antifa: What it is? Antifa = “Anti-Fascist” movement. Not an organisation but a loosely connected network of activists opposing fascism, white supremacy, and far-right extremism. Editorial Analysis: Revitalizing India’s MSMEs for Inclusive Growth

General Studies-3; Topic: Effects of liberalization on the economy, changes in industrial policy and their effects on industrial growth.   Introduction MSMEs as growth engines: Contribute 30% to GDP, employ 100+ million people, and drive 49% of exports.
